For the most recent IPEDS reporting year, Western New Mexico University conferred 49 master’s degrees in teacher education grade specific.
Western New Mexico University is among the very best schools in the country for teacher education grade specific at the master’s level. In particular it placed #1 out of 1 schools by College Factual.
In the most recent graduating class, 22% of teacher education grade specific master’s degrees went to men and 78% went to women.
The largest share of teacher education grade specific master’s degree graduates at Western New Mexico University are Hispanic or Latino. Approximately 55%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Western New Mexico University with a master’s in teacher education grade specific.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 0 |
| Black or African American | 1 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 27 |
| White | 17 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 0 |
| Other Races | 4 |
Western New Mexico University conferred 38 master’s completions in teacher education, multiple levels recently — 84% to women and 16% to men. The largest share of these graduates were Hispanic or Latino (58%).
Western New Mexico University granted 7 master’s degrees in secondary education and teaching in the latest year of data — 29% to women and 71% to men. The largest share of these graduates were Hispanic or Latino (57%).
Western New Mexico University granted 3 master’s completions in elementary education and teaching recently — 100% to women and 0% to men. Most of these graduates identified as White (100%).
Western New Mexico University conferred 1 master’s degree in early childhood education and teaching recently — 100% to women and 0% to men. Most of these graduates identified as Hispanic or Latino (100%).

In the most recent graduating class, 33% of teacher education grade specific graduate certificate degrees went to men and 67% went to women.
The largest share of teacher education grade specific graduate certificate degree graduates at Western New Mexico University are Hispanic or Latino. About 53%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Western New Mexico University with a graduate certificate in teacher education grade specific.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 0 |
| Black or African American | 0 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 23 |
| White | 19 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 0 |
| Other Races | 1 |
Western New Mexico University conferred 23 graduate certificate completions in secondary education and teaching in the most recent reporting year — 48% to women and 52% to men. Most of these graduates identified as Hispanic or Latino (52%).
Western New Mexico University awarded 13 graduate certificate degrees in elementary education and teaching in the most recent reporting year — 85% to women and 15% to men. Most of these graduates identified as Hispanic or Latino (62%).
Western New Mexico University awarded 7 graduate certificate completions in kindergarten/preschool education and teaching recently — 100% to women and 0% to men. The largest share of these graduates were White (57%).
